You can fish in the Loxahatchee River. The Loxahatchee River in Jupiter is a wide body of water named from the Native American Seminole word for “river of turtles”. The most popular species caught on the Loxahatchee Riverfront are Snook, Crevalle jack, and Mangrove snapper. Hook and line are the only permissible forms of fishing.

The Loxahatchee River is a 7.6-mile river near the southeast coast of Florida. It is a National Wild and Scenic River, one of only two in the state, and received its federal designation on May 17, 1985. The Loxahatchee River flows out of the Jupiter Inlet and into the Atlantic Ocean.

The Lord’s Place transforms lives by providing solutions that break the cycle of homelessness for the most vulnerable and neglected in Palm Beach County. Recently, Representative Lois Frankel presented nearly one million dollars to the Lord’s Place in West Palm Beach to help the organization rebuild its family campus located on Haverhill Road. The organization houses thirty-seven families. The check was in the amount of $998,900. The money is a part of community project funding and the 2022 spending bill passed by Congress earlier this month.

Try traditional Spanish cuisine at one of the fantastic Boca Raton tapas bars.  A tapas bar is well-known for tasty small plates, appetizer portions, of distinct types of Spanish fare, a glass of wine, and pals. Popular throughout Spain, tapas are festive and delicious appetizers and snacks. Traditional tapas include mixed olives, fried baby squid, meatballs, and chorizo. Tapas have evolved into a stylish cuisine that can serve as a full meal.
